Abstract
A computer that includes a processor and a memory, the memory including instructions executable by the processor to execute a multi-task learning (MTL) neural network that includes multi-task layers and single-task layers, and that is configured to receive an image as input to a first one of the multi-task layers and to output respective predictions for each of a plurality of tasks from respective ones of the single-task layers. Activation tensors can be output from the multi-task layers and can be provided as input to the single-task layers.
